Abstract:Environmental factors have a huge impact on the development of gynaecological cancers. Avoidance of tobacco and of unsafe sex, adherence to a balanced diet rich in fruit and vegetables, moderate exercise and use of the oral contraceptive will all substantially reduce a woman’s risk. Regular Pap smear screening is very protective against the subsequent development of cancer of the cervix but unfortunately, screening tests for endometrial and ovarian cancers are currently not available.
